What is Diploma in Chemical Engineering?

Diploma in Chemical Engineering is a 3-year polytechnic programme covering chemical process technology, plant equipment operation, industrial chemistry, and process instrumentation & control. It trains students to work in the plants that convert raw materials into chemicals, fuels, fertilisers, pharmaceuticals and processed food products — a genuinely technical, process-oriented field distinct from other engineering diplomas.

It's offered at government polytechnics run by each state's technical education board, as well as private AICTE-approved polytechnic institutes, though availability is somewhat more concentrated in states with significant chemical/petrochemical industry presence, like Gujarat and Maharashtra.

What you'll actually study

Subjects & syllabus

Semester rangeTypical subjects
Semesters 1-2Basic Chemical Engineering, Industrial Chemistry, Engineering Mathematics, Chemical Laboratory Practice
Semesters 3-4Chemical Process Technology, Heat & Mass Transfer Fundamentals, Plant Equipment & Operations, Process Instrumentation
Semesters 5-6Process Control, Industrial Safety & Environmental Engineering, Petroleum/Petrochemical Technology, an industrial training/project

Exact subject names and semester distribution vary by state technical education board — this reflects a typical, commonly followed structure.

A genuinely important part of the field

Industrial safety training

Why it mattersChemical plants handle hazardous, flammable and sometimes toxic materials under specific pressure/temperature conditions — safety isn't optional, it's foundational to the work.
What's coveredHazard identification, personal protective equipment (PPE) use, emergency response procedures, and understanding material safety data sheets (MSDS).
Industry standardsPlants follow established safety protocols and regulations, and employees typically undergo additional site-specific safety induction training before starting work.
Career relevanceStrong safety awareness and discipline is genuinely valued by employers and directly affects hiring and workplace trust in this field.
Very affordable at government polytechnics

Fees & scholarships

Government polytechnic fees for the full 3-year diploma are typically in the range of ₹15,000-60,000, making it one of the most affordable technical qualifications in India. Private polytechnic institutes charge considerably more, often ₹60,000-1.5 lakh per year. Merit-based, SC/ST and income-linked scholarships are available at most government institutions. Always confirm current fees directly on your target institute's official admission page.

Beyond the diploma

Lateral entry & higher studies

Lateral entry is the standard upgrade path — diploma holders can join the second year of a B.Tech/B.E. in Chemical Engineering directly, through a state lateral entry exam or quota, at AICTE-approved engineering colleges. Others add certifications in industrial safety (NEBOSH or equivalent), quality control systems, or specific process technologies to strengthen their technical profile and open up safety-officer or quality-lead career tracks.

Common myths

Myths vs facts

Myth: Chemical plants are inherently unsafe places to work.

Fact: Modern chemical plants operate under strict, mandatory safety protocols and regular training — while risks exist, they are actively and systematically managed as standard industry practice.

Myth: This diploma only leads to work at oil refineries.

Fact: Graduates also work in pharmaceuticals, fertilisers, paints, food processing and various chemical manufacturing sectors — refining is one of several possible industries.

Myth: You need to already know advanced chemistry to start this diploma.

Fact: The diploma teaches industrial chemistry and process technology from the fundamentals — Class 10-level chemistry knowledge is sufficient to begin.
